Definition
To sell more of something than is available or to exaggerate how good something is when promoting it.

Listen in Context
The hotel was oversold, so some guests had no rooms.
Don't oversell the product; be honest about its features.
The company tends to oversell its new services.
He really oversold his cooking skills, and the meal wasn't that great.
